dockerfile 385 B

12345678910111213141516
  1. FROM python:3.10-slim
  2. # copy main binary to /main
  3. COPY main /main
  4. COPY conf/config.yaml /conf/config.yaml
  5. # change source to TSINGHUA if environment['TSINGHUA'] is set
  6. ARG TSINGHUA
  7. RUN apt-get clean && \
  8. apt-get update && apt-get install -y pkg-config libseccomp-dev \
  9. && rm -rf /var/lib/apt/lists/* \
  10. && chmod +x /main \
  11. && pip3 install jinja2
  12. ENTRYPOINT ["/main"]